An eаrthmоving cоntrаctоr is evаluating whether to use a larger excavator to reduce current operating costs. The excavator can be purchased at $135,000 and is expected to have a useful life of 5 years after which it can be sold for $25,000. The optimistic, most likely, and pessimistic projections of annual savings in operating costs are $40,000, $30,000, and $14,000, respectively. Use the range of estimates method to compute the mean annual savings, and then determine the present worth of purchasing this excavator at 7% interest.

"Guernica" is a famous painting by the Spanish artist Pablo Picasso, created in 1937 in response to the bombing of the Basque town of Guernica by German and Italian warplanes during the Spanish Civil War.
